NCISM introduces pre-Ayurveda course for students in Sanskrit Gurukulams – Times of India

The National Commission for Indian Systems of Medicine (NCISM) under the Ministry of Ayush plans to introduce a 7-years programme for students studying in Sanskrit gurukulams after class X to study pre-Ayurveda. These courses will be taught in Gurukulam which will soon be set up across the country which will require the affiliation of NCISM. The new regulations will help students from Sanskrit Gurukulams affiliated to State Sanskrit Boards.
